Town of International Friendship `INUYAMA`

Inuyama is an ancient castle town located in the northwest of Aichi Prefecture. It is part of the Hida-Kiso Quasi-National Park. The town is noted for historical sites and its natural beauty. Inuyama Castle, the center of the town, was built by a warrior general, Nobuyasu Oda, in 1537. The history of the town, however, goes back to the ancient `Kofun` period, when people built many gigantic mound-like tombs. Inuyama has grown as a tourist town because of its historical sites, old temples and shrines, and other tourist attractions. In 1987, it was designated an International Tourism Area.
